Description:
Poly(ethyl methacrylate) (PEMA) is a synthetic polymer derived from the polymerization of ethyl methacrylate monomers. It is characterized by its clear, transparent appearance and excellent optical properties, making it suitable for applications in optics and coatings. PEMA exhibits good thermal stability and resistance to UV light, which contributes to its durability in various environments. The polymer is known for its flexibility and impact resistance, which allows it to be used in applications ranging from adhesives to automotive parts. Additionally, PEMA has a low water absorption rate, enhancing its performance in moisture-sensitive applications. Its chemical structure provides a balance of rigidity and elasticity, making it versatile for use in both rigid and flexible products. PEMA can be processed through various methods, including casting and extrusion, and can be modified with additives to enhance specific properties, such as flame retardancy or color. Overall, PEMA is valued for its combination of mechanical strength, aesthetic qualities, and adaptability in diverse industrial applications.
